Transaction 2501479e73ed19194d9fd6db1124af5b8397839f3df336f9139472dd23fbe52e
1 Input
2 Outputs
- 2501479e73ed19194d9fd6db1124af5b8397839f3df336f9139472dd23fbe52e:0
- 2501479e73ed19194d9fd6db1124af5b8397839f3df336f9139472dd23fbe52e:1
value 4107975
address 3PtUCE9EB63RVbsFgSpmDsw4eHr5H6Upqn
value 32927709
address 14gvLQhxYwe8b6ES2HpRhZAKe8MN6e5hzQ